What is Recycled Plastic Desiccant Masterbatch?

Recycled Plastic Desiccant Masterbatch is a mix of recycled plastic and special desiccant materials. These materials absorb moisture effectively. Manufacturers use this masterbatch in various plastic products to enhance their durability and longevity.

How Does it Work?

The functionality of Recycled Plastic Desiccant Masterbatch can be understood through a few simple steps:

  1. Collection of Plastic Waste: First, plastic waste is gathered from various sources. This includes bottles, containers, and industrial scraps.
  2. Recycling Process: Next, the collected plastic is processed. It is cleaned, shredded, and melted down to form pellets.
  3. Mixing Desiccants: During the production of the masterbatch, desiccant materials are mixed with the recycled plastic pellets. These desiccants are often made from substances like silica gel or other moisture-absorbing agents.
  4. Creating Masterbatch: The mixture is then compounded into a masterbatch. This means it is blended thoroughly to ensure even distribution of the desiccants within the plastic.
  5. Manufacturing Products: Finally, this Recycled Plastic Desiccant Masterbatch is used by manufacturers to create a wide range of plastic goods, from packaging to automotive parts.

Benefits of Using Recycled Plastic Desiccant Masterbatch

So, why should manufacturers choose this method? Here are several key advantages:

  • Environmental Impact: Using recycled materials reduces the need for new plastic production, leading to less waste and lower energy consumption.
  • Moisture Control: The desiccants in the masterbatch help prevent moisture damage, which is crucial for products like electronics and food packaging.
  • Cost-Effective: Incorporating recycled plastic can lower production costs, making it an attractive option for manufacturers.
  • Versatility: This masterbatch can be used in various applications, making it a flexible choice for different industries.
